现代技术的发展使得接口成为了软件和硬件系统之间不可或缺的沟通桥梁。不同类型的接口根据其功能和应用场景的不同,展现出各自独特的特性。在信息交流日益频繁的今天,了解这些接口的适用情况,有助于开发者和用户在选择技术解决方案时做出明智的决策。本文将深入分析几种最为常见的接口类型及其适用的场景,以帮助您更好地理解如何在各种技术环境中有效地应用这些接口。

API(应用程序接口)是一种使不同软件程序能够相互通信的工具,通常用于网络服务和应用开发。API的应用范围广泛,从社交媒体的数据共享到支付处理系统的集成,几乎无处不在。尤其是在构建微服务架构时,API的设计和实现至关重要,它能够帮助开发者以模块化的方式构建灵活的应用程序。
接下来,我们来看一下数据接口。数据接口以数据传输为主要功能,主要用于数据库之间或应用程序与数据库之间的交互。数据接口通常采用标准化的协议,以确保数据的一致性和准确性。对于需要频繁访问和处理大量数据的企业来说,选择合适的数据接口能够提升整体工作效率,实现更好的数据利用。
用户界面接口(UI接口)也扮演着重要角色。UI接口主要关注人与机器之间的互动,是用户操作系统和应用程序的桥梁。良好的UI设计不仅能提高用户的操作体验,还能增加软件产品的市场竞争力。在开发新软件时,重视UI接口的设计是确保用户满意度的关键因素。
硬件接口则是连接计算机与外部设备的实体通道,包括USB、HDMI等多种类型。这类接口处理的是物理连接,确保数据在设备间传输的稳定性。在选择硬件接口时,考虑设备的兼容性和未来扩展需求尤为重要,这能够避免因接口不适应而导致的功能限制。
通过对不同接口类型的了解,我们可以更好地选择合适的技术方案,无论是在软件开发还是硬件连接方面。深入掌握这些知识,不仅有助于提升工作效率,也能为技术应用的成功奠定基础。希望本文能为您在相关领域的探索提供一些有益的思路与指导。
